About 1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ide
1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ide (PubChem CID 113191387) has the molecular formula C20H20Cl2N2O2
and a molecular weight of 391.30 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ide.

What is the SMILES notation for 1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ide?
The canonical SMILES for 1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ide is CC(C)c1ccc(NC(=O)C2CC(=O)N(c3cccc(Cl)c3Cl)C2)cc1.
What is the InChIKey of 1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ide?
The InChIKey is AVJPAUZCNDXQLV-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C20H20Cl2N2O2/c1-12(2)13-6-8-15(9-7-13)23-20(26)14-10-18(25)24(11-14)17-5-3-4-16(21)19(17)22/h3-9,12,14H,10-11H2,1-2H3,(H,23,26).
What are the key properties of 1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ide?
1-(2,3-dichlorophenyl)-5-oxo-N-(4-propan-2-ylphenyl)pyrrolidine-3-carboxamide has a molecular weight of 391.30 g/mol, XLogP of 5.11, 4 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 2 hydrogen bond acceptors.
